Bagikan melalui


Antarmuka IWDFIoQueue (wudfddi.h)

[Peringatan: UMDF 2 adalah versi terbaru UMDF dan pengganti UMDF 1. Semua driver UMDF baru harus ditulis menggunakan UMDF 2. Tidak ada fitur baru yang ditambahkan ke UMDF 1 dan ada dukungan terbatas untuk UMDF 1 pada versi Windows 10 yang lebih baru. Driver Universal Windows harus menggunakan UMDF 2. Untuk informasi selengkapnya, lihat Mulai menggunakan UMDF.]

Antarmuka IWDFIoQueue mengekspos objek antrean I/O.

Warisan

Antarmuka IWDFIoQueue mewarisi dari IWDFObject. IWDFIoQueue juga memiliki jenis anggota ini:

  • Metode

Metode

Antarmuka IWDFIoQueue memiliki metode ini.

 
IWDFIoQueue::ConfigureRequestDispatching

Metode ConfigureRequestDispatching mengonfigurasi antrean permintaan I/O dari jenis yang diberikan.
IWDFIoQueue::D rain

Metode Pengurasan mengarahkan antrean untuk menolak permintaan I/O masuk baru dan memungkinkan permintaan yang sudah diantrekan dikirimkan ke driver untuk diproses.
IWDFIoQueue::D rainSynchronously

Metode DrainSynchronously mengarahkan antrean untuk menolak permintaan I/O masuk baru dan memungkinkan permintaan yang sudah diantrekan dikirimkan ke driver untuk diproses. Metode ini kembali setelah semua permintaan selesai atau dibatalkan.
IWDFIoQueue::GetDevice

Metode GetDevice mengambil antarmuka ke perangkat yang memiliki antrean I/O.
IWDFIoQueue::GetState

Metode GetState mengambil status antrean I/O.
IWDFIoQueue::P urge

Metode Pembersihan mengarahkan kerangka kerja untuk menolak permintaan I/O masuk baru dan membatalkan semua permintaan yang belum terpenuhi.
IWDFIoQueue::P urgeSynchronously

Metode PurgeSynchronously mengarahkan kerangka kerja untuk menolak permintaan I/O masuk baru dan membatalkan semua permintaan yang luar biasa. Metode ini kembali setelah semua permintaan yang terutang dibatalkan.
IWDFIoQueue::RetrieveNextRequest

Metode RetrieveNextRequest mengambil permintaan I/O berikutnya dari antrean I/O.
IWDFIoQueue::RetrieveNextRequestByFileObject

Metode RetrieveNextRequestByFileObject mengambil dari antrean I/O permintaan I/O berikutnya yang objek filenya cocok dengan objek file yang ditentukan.
IWDFIoQueue::Start

Metode Mulai memungkinkan antrean I/O untuk mulai menerima permintaan I/O baru dan mengirimkannya ke driver.
IWDFIoQueue::Stop

Metode Hentikan mencegah antrean I/O mengirimkan permintaan I/O, tetapi antrean menerima dan menyimpan permintaan baru.
IWDFIoQueue::StopSynchronously

Metode StopSynchronously mencegah antrean I/O mengirimkan permintaan I/O, tetapi antrean menerima dan menyimpan permintaan baru. Metode ini kembali setelah semua permintaan yang dikirim telah dibatalkan atau diselesaikan.

Persyaratan

Persyaratan Nilai
Akhir dukungan Tidak tersedia di UMDF 2.0 dan yang lebih baru.
Target Platform Desktop
Versi UMDF minimum 1,5
Header wudfddi.h